Recommendation for readers who are interested in exploring the subject even more

For readers captivated by the mysteries of the afterlife, "Is Death The Final Destination?: A Glimpse of The Afterlife" by John White is a captivating read that delves into profound questions. To even more explore this thought-provoking subject, think about diving into works like "Life After Life" by Raymond Moody and "The Tibetan Book of Living and Dying" by Sogyal Rinpoche.

These books offer diverse perspectives on what lies beyond our earthly existence, enhancing your understanding of the afterlife. Furthermore, checking out Near-Death Experience (NDE) accounts shared in books such as "Proof of Heaven" by Eben Alexander can supply remarkable insights into the possible extension of awareness post-death.
